Policymakers at all levels of government are debating a wide range of options for addressing the nation’s faltering economic conditions. One option that is once again receiving attention is accelerated investments in the nation’s public infrastructure – that is, highways, mass transit, airports, water supply and wastewater, and other facilities – in order to create jobs while also promoting long-term economic growth. This book discusses policy issues associated with using infrastructure as a mechanism to benefit economic recovery. Discussed are the roles of infrastructure investment in economic growth generally and in contributing to bolstering a faltering economy. Key issues include the potential role of traditional and "green" infrastructure in creating jobs, timing and setting priorities.
